The following information of Mamta Tyagi is given on 31 December 2017. Bank balance as per the passbook is Rs. 10,000. Dividend of Rs. 2,000 was collected by the bank but was entered in the cash book as Rs. 200. What is the cash book bank-balance ? Correct Answer Rs. 8,200

Key Points

In the above question dividend of Rs. 2000, collected by the bank was posted to cashbook as Rs. 200, which will result in a shortfall of Rs. 1800(2000-200) in the cashbook.

So, as per the question, the Bank balance in the cashbook will be Rs. 10000-1800 = Rs. 8200.
